51 Studio celebrates first birthday
Graphic design company 51 Studio is celebrating its one-year anniversary today (1 March).
The company was started by Creative Director David Tetley in 2010, becoming a fully-fledged business on March 1 2011 – the day which also saw the appointment of Managing Director Anouska Wilkinson and the move into their first office at Plymouth University’s Formation Zone.
The Formation Zone, which is a part of GAIN, provided 51 Studio with the support it needed to get going and introduced David and Anouska to two other new businesses, Altitude and Actuate Marketing, with whom 51 Studio has now formed a full-service creative agency.
The three businesses have now moved together to new studio space at Royal William Yard where they continue to expand as a consortium.
Managing Director Anouska Wilkinson said: “What a year it has been - we’ve moved, tripled our client base, worked with the NHS, Plymouth City Council, Bristol Council, lots of start ups and community initiative ‘The Union Street Project’. And we are currently working on a number of exciting projects with like-minded clients. We would like to thank all of our clients for making it a successful year and look forward to working with you all in the future to create something special!”
